Comparatives & superlatives (Long adjectives) Primary Longman Elect 4A Chapter 3 Comparatives & superlatives (Long adjectives)

Comparatives: Long adjectives Use more before long adjectives to make the comparative form. badminton Chinese checkers               Badminton is more popular than Chinese checkers.

Comparatives: Long adjectives Use the word more to make the comparative form. Long adjectives Examples Candy is more polite than Maggie. Jacky is more helpful than Tom. Most two-syllable adjectives which do not end in -y Oranges are more delicious than apples. Potato chips are more popular than sour plums. All adjectives of three syllables or more

Comparatives: Long adjectives more helpful e.g. helpful  1 polite  2 cheerful  3 delicious  4 popular  5 expensive  6 interesting  more polite more cheerful more delicious more popular more expensive more interesting

Superlatives: Long adjectives Use the + most before long adjectives to make the superlative form. lemon sweets peanuts cookies $25 $30 $50 The peanuts are more expensive than the lemon sweets. The cookies are the most expensive snack.

Superlatives: Long adjectives the most helpful e.g. helpful  1 polite  2 cheerful  3 delicious  4 popular  5 expensive  6 interesting  the most polite the most cheerful the most delicous the most popular the most expensive the most interesting
